JAPANESE BEGIN DRIVE

ERADICATION OF CHINESE TO CLEAR THREE PROVINCES CHINCHOW MAIN OBJECTIVE ASSAULT SUDDENLY BEGUN

By Telegraph—Press Assn.—Copyright. Rec. 1 a.m. Shanghai, Dec. 21

Waiving the formality of an ultimatum, the Japanese army in Manchuria to-day began a drive aiming at total eradication of Chinese influence in the three eastern provinces, and having Ohinchow, the provisional eeat of Government, as the main objective. It is reported that fighting commenced last evening with a Japanese aerial attack pending the arrival of troops opposing 10,000 Chinese regulars who are moving to an attack on Mukden. •
